My experience is that there continue to be bugs in filled contours,
particularly when there are missing data, and when the contours "bleed"
off the plot. Some contours dont get filled in, and others overrun
adjacent areas (?).

3.6.1a is suppose to have some fixes to these problems, and here is
something from rel_dotes.doc:

6/29/94
Added a new keyword, CELL_FILL, to CONTOUR that fills
each cell on an individual basis. This method avoids
many of the problems with /FILL in which contours that
hit missing data cells or edges of maps are not filled.
The disadvantage of this method is that many small
polygons are produced. Also fixed some bugs with /FILL
that caused incorrectly colored areas.


My Note: you have to add /cell_fill, not replace /fill.

I just did a quick test of this, and things seem to be better, but
not all the way fixed (I think). I dont see any more overruning
adjacent areas, but I've still got non filled areas. This is just a
quick look, and I will look at it closer.
Note I use map_set, /cylindrical to establish my coord. system. I suspect
that contouring does better in other coord systems.
